Based on the original Rey Collection designed by Swiss designer Bruno Rey in 1971, HAY has teamed up with Dietiker to present the Rey Chair, Stool, and Bar Stool, along with the Bruno Rey Table and Coffee Table, in a new updated form.

Centred around the acclaimed stackable chair design, which combines cast aluminum brackets with wooden parts, the entire collection is unified by a shared language of rounded edges and robust connections.

The collection retains the functionality and resilience of the classic designs and has been modified with new dimensions to accommodate contemporary lifestyle requirements. Rey is available in both the original colours as well as new tones and upholstery options selected by HAY.

This product range is suitable for domestic, corporate or commercial settings.

Colour: Cream White, Deep Black, Deep Blue, Fall Green, Golden, Grape Red, Scarlet Red, Slate Blue, Soft Mint, Umber Brown

Materials: Moulded plywood with beech veneer. Legs in solid beech. Plastic Gliders.

Dimensions: H 80 x W 44 x D 49 cm

Seat Height: 46.5cm

Seat Depth: 44cm

Weight 6.3 kg

Designer Info:

HAY was founded in 2002 with the ambition to create contemporary furniture with an eye for modern living and sophisticated industrial manufacturing. That remains there ambition today. Through our commitment to the design and production of furniture, lighting and accessories with an international appeal they strive to make good design accessible to the largest possible audience.

They are inspired by the stable structures of architecture and the dynamics of fashion, which they seek to combine in durable quality products that provide added value for the user. HAY’s continued vision is to create straightforward, functional and aesthetic design in cooperation with some of the world’s most talented, curious and courageous designers.
